Cyrtomium fortunei Ulleung Island Hibiscus Pyrrosia lingua cultivars hate growingCyrtomium fortunei 'Ulleung Island' is our 2002 spore grown introduction, from our 1997 expedition to the volcanic Ulleung Island off the Korean coast. We originally had this fern identified as Cyrtomium balansae but are now certain that it is actually a form of Cyrtomium fortunei.
